The liability and responsibility for goods pass from seller to buyer at the point that goods are agreed to be FOB. However, the FOB principle does not correlate to payment terms. This usually is a matter of separate negotiation. Therefore, FOB is a mechanism for agreeing on price and transport responsibility, not for agreeing on payment terms.

The two businesses share their finances, income, and expenses. A JV formed between a local and a foreign company, organization, or individual is called an international joint venture. The company shares resources and builds business relationships with those in the host country to carry out cross-border economic activities. International JVs most often involve only two parent companies but may include multiple participants as well.
